Does Photoshop Elements allow you to open & manipulate EPS files? Thanks.

Yes and no – mostly no 😉

When you open an EPS file, PSE rasterizes it. If you save it as an EPS, PSE creates an EPS file with a single rasterized object. IOW, assumiung the starting EPS consisted of individually editable vestor objects, those go away and become part of the single rasterized object.
